Glad to leave Castel Volturno, finding peace in the countryside again before a busy arrival in Naples

Back in the countryside towards Naples

I didn’t get much sleep last night. Every little noise I heard woke me up. To give some context, I was the only guest, alone in the B&B at Castel Volturno and every other house in the street was abandoned and derelict – like the whole town itself. I did not feel particularly safe, though I was indeed locked in the house. I was glad when the time to leave finally came.

Sighting Vesuvio on approach to Naples

I elected to go back inland and not follow the coastline to Naples, as it was quite a depressing sight. It turned out the countryside was a good choice. I was quickly back onto some quiet and beautiful places and was able to enjoy my surroundings again, mountains, endless fields and animals. As always when approaching a big city, I was aware that things would get busy inevitably. Last week to this day I reached Rome and I remember how tough it was.

Colours of Naples…

Well, Naples was no different in this sense. About 10km or so before reaching the city centre, traffic got mad. Sidewalks were inadequately suited for the stroller and I ended up running on the road mostly, generating plenty of angry honks (and a few encouragements too, let’s not forget these as they were very kind and appreciated). I didn’t get to see the city itself nor Vesuvio till the very last moment, at a turn of the road. And it was quite a sight! I am glad I have all of tomorrow to walk through the city and visit a place I have never seen before.
